Document: Selection parameters ω i . We only use a single type of MCMC move to alter ω i across the codon sequence: changing ω i at a given site i. We assume an exponential prior with parameter λ ω for ω i . Following the existing model [4] , a new value ω i is chosen such that ω i = ω i exp(U ), where U ∼ Uniform(−1, 1) and the acceptance probability is
